What is python-webtest
python-webtest is:
WebTest helps you test your WSGI-based web applications. This can be any application that has a WSGI (Web Server Gateway Interface) interface, including an application written in a framework that supports WSGI (which includes most actively developed Python web frameworks ?? almost anything that even nominally supports WSGI should be testable).

Install python-webtest Using apt-get
Update apt database with apt-get
using the following command.
sudo apt-get update
After updating apt database, We can install python-webtest
using apt-get
by running the following command:
sudo apt-get -y install python-webtest

How To Uninstall python-webtest on Debian 9
To uninstall only the python-webtest
package we can use the following command:
sudo apt-get remove python-webtest
Uninstall python-webtest And Its Dependencies
To uninstall python-webtest
and its dependencies that are no longer needed by Debian 9, we can use the command below:
sudo apt-get -y autoremove python-webtest
Remove python-webtest Configurations and Data
To remove python-webtest
configuration and data from Debian 9 we can use the following command:
sudo apt-get -y purge python-webtest
Remove python-webtest configuration, data, and all of its dependencies
We can use the following command to remove python-webtest
configurations, data and all of its dependencies, we can use the following command:
sudo apt-get -y autoremove --purge python-webtest
